* B10 - Wedmesday, Sept. 2, 1981 - North Shore News Young runners set records To anybody who has been watching the young North Shore track and field athictes in competition this year it should come as no surprise that they set two meet records and picked up a healthy collection of medals. While Graeme Bowbrick knocked over 15 seconds off the 3000 metre mark to take the gold in a time of 9:09.1, Janice Bain of Lions Bay took over four seconds off the mark in the girls division of the same event. Bain took the gold in a time of 10:27 8. As the North Shore was not a independent zone, (Zone 5 also consisted of much of Vancouver, the Sunshine Coast, and Squamish) its athietes also contributed to teams made up from the entire zone. Susan Carlile for example, played on the women’s field hockey team that captured the gold medal, and the West Vancouver athicte contributed onc goal in the team’s 4-2 victory over Zonc 1, on the way to. the championship. While it was the medal winning that stood out, there were a number of ncar-miss fourth place performances, by competitors such as the pins softball tcam, aumerous swimmers and West sailor Max Foxall. Aad then there were some sports, such as synchronized swimming and the cquestnan cvents, in which the North Shore athictes were hopclessly outclassed. But they came and competed anyway, ang by all accounts scemed to have a really good time - which, shall we be tntc. ss what it was all about.
